Capes we can listen after if they make the zip sound but some original capes does not make the sound. That is very tricky.
Some original sabers does not glow under black light and they are still orignal, very tricky again. I also try to get some capes and sabers from childhood collections but all the sabers I have found in childhood collections and capes do glow and make zip sound.
